🔴 Netflix Backend in React Native & AWS Amplify (Tutorial for Beginners)

  Рет қаралды 145,081

notJust․dev

notJust․dev

Күн бұрын

Let's build Netflix mobile app from scratch using React Native and AWS Amplify (beginner friendly)
📚 Enroll NOW for "The Full-stack Mobile Developer" and save 30%
academy.notjust.dev/
This is a great and fun opportunity to learn and practice hybrid mobile development with React Native and AWS Amplify for everybody, from beginners to professionals. Let's learn together 📖💡
🎒 Download the Asset Bundle (Images, Dummy data, PDF presentation):
assets.notjust.dev/netflix
👇 Install Expo to follow along. This video is sponsored by Expo
bit.ly/expo-vadim
🐱‍💻 Source code
github.com/Savinvadim1312/Net...
💬 Join the notJust Development gang and let's build together
/ discord
Tag me on social media when you finish this build, and I will give you feedback on your project.
LinkedIn: / vadimsavin
IG: / vadimsavin0
Twitter: / savinvadim_
Timecodes:
00:00 Intro
05:48 Prerequisites
10:00 Init the Expo project
14:30 Setup Bottom Tab Navigator
34:23 Home Screen: Render Movie Poster Image
51:50 Home Screen: Render a list of movies (FlatList)
1:00:00 Home Category Component
1:20:30 Movie Details Screen
2:10:31 Episode component
2:28:38 Render the list of episodes
2:34:49 Season Dropdown Picker
2:51:06 Video Player
3:42:01 Q&A
#VadimSavin #notjustdev #notJustDevelopment

Пікірлер: 53
@jeffjcd
@jeffjcd 2 жыл бұрын
Always Great Content! Jeff(Your Miami Fan)
@donjohnkz
@donjohnkz 2 жыл бұрын
Hellow from Brazil !!! Thanks for the content, a question: How would it be to do this with only javascript? having typescript seems to be very confusing, especially in a project that was initially created with javascript, I don't have much experience with typescript ..
@Thestorryteller2
@Thestorryteller2 6 ай бұрын
finnaly i found this helping tutorial for aws amplify
@QueroAlmofadas
@QueroAlmofadas 2 жыл бұрын
Gosto demais dos seus vídeos fico contando os minutos para assistir novo vídeo
@surajali1236
@surajali1236 3 жыл бұрын
Thank you sir, For your effort it will help everyone like us who are students. God bless you.
@notjustdev
@notjustdev 3 жыл бұрын
It's my pleasure
@rudyramkissoon2276
@rudyramkissoon2276 2 жыл бұрын
Hello I love the tutorial. I have a question. 1. How can I download the full source code?
@HunterZoy
@HunterZoy 3 жыл бұрын
1:52:09 Aren't we losing the benefits of using GraphQL instead of a REST API ? I mean, thanks to the connection directive, we were supposed to get the movies when querying a category ? Or i'm misunderstanding something ?
@GeraldoLopez
@GeraldoLopez 3 жыл бұрын
Great job man!!!
@notjustdev
@notjustdev 3 жыл бұрын
Thank you! Cheers!
@geneartista9714
@geneartista9714 2 жыл бұрын
sir how about the download (download, pause, resume) part using expo file system
@iFranzOSX
@iFranzOSX 3 жыл бұрын
Hello, thank you so much for the great content. Quick Question is there a way to change the design of the aws login screen?. Thanks
@notjustdev
@notjustdev 3 жыл бұрын
Yes. YOu can design the UI yourself, and call some functions provided by Auth module (such as signIn, signUp, etc.)
@montassarelkamel7564
@montassarelkamel7564 3 жыл бұрын
Can you do an e-scooter rental app like bird or Lime clone ?
@filemon81
@filemon81 2 жыл бұрын
BOA valeu mesmo!
@fyzmuhammed4504
@fyzmuhammed4504 2 жыл бұрын
Bro then we can see the listed movies ? Using our own projects?
@michael-shakaikhanoba9810
@michael-shakaikhanoba9810 3 жыл бұрын
Thank you sir
@michael-shakaikhanoba9810
@michael-shakaikhanoba9810 3 жыл бұрын
Downloads styling for both android and ios
@shivamdubey4783
@shivamdubey4783 Жыл бұрын
one question how can we use reccomendation system in react native
@bhavikbhavsar
@bhavikbhavsar 3 жыл бұрын
will this also work with android tv .. do we have any specific setting that can be added for it to work
@prasad3673
@prasad3673 3 жыл бұрын
How to do LongPressEvent Hardware Back button to exit the app
@okeyshourovroy2769
@okeyshourovroy2769 3 жыл бұрын
I have a question. If we use aws video on deman to provide private videos like Netflix, so if we protect the video content from downloading or prevent watch to them who are not in subscription. So we need to assign a ip or domain maybe to tell aws, connect with only this ip or domain. So in this case how we can use the same thing in react native? Like in web ReactJs which has a domain but what about the react native. Hope you will answer this. Thanks in advance.
@notjustdev
@notjustdev 3 жыл бұрын
In this case you can limit access not based on ip, but based on identities wich are assigned to users when they sign up to your application with cognito. You can limit access to some content only to users that are part of one group (pro users), so only they can read from that bucket. Furthermore, you can create an admin group, and give access to only this group to add content in that bucket.
@okeyshourovroy2769
@okeyshourovroy2769 3 жыл бұрын
@@notjustdev thank you for your reply. I hope you will try to cover it in nodejs mongodb expressjs and react native series without aws. 😀
@nikhil7053
@nikhil7053 3 жыл бұрын
nice bro waiting for your next one,plz add credit card and debit card or stripe
@ahmadazharbinatalib7303
@ahmadazharbinatalib7303 3 жыл бұрын
Yes sir..very good info..thankyou very2 much all team bisnes online F B..
@seanknowles9985
@seanknowles9985 11 ай бұрын
Would love to see a CDK project properly linked with Amplify.
@blower2006
@blower2006 11 ай бұрын
why do you guys have a color grading panel??
@ahmadazharbinatalib7303
@ahmadazharbinatalib7303 3 жыл бұрын
Ok..thankyou sir and all frient compeny...
@ionicamarian352
@ionicamarian352 2 жыл бұрын
Where are you from bro?
@aldencarcamo5944
@aldencarcamo5944 3 жыл бұрын
Good morning bro
@NamLe-sl4qy
@NamLe-sl4qy Жыл бұрын
Your GraphQL Schema is using "@connection", "@key" directives from an older version of the GraphQL Transformer
@kunkugouthamkrishna9088
@kunkugouthamkrishna9088 3 жыл бұрын
Amazing stuff you got there man !!! Can you build a real world game or something like that next?
@michael-shakaikhanoba9810
@michael-shakaikhanoba9810 3 жыл бұрын
Downloads profile with recently watched
@notjustdev
@notjustdev 3 жыл бұрын
🎒 Download the Asset Bundle: assets.notjust.dev/netflix 👇 Install Expo to follow along. This video is sponsored by Expo: bit.ly/expo-vadim 📚 Enroll in "The Full-stack Mobile Developer" and become a 6-figure dev in 2021: academy.notjust.dev/
@kiencuong7363
@kiencuong7363 3 жыл бұрын
@KING Lvl999 夢 pllu ư,
@martmyamnusaibah2499
@martmyamnusaibah2499 3 жыл бұрын
@KING Lvl999 夢 eyf
@Stus777
@Stus777 3 жыл бұрын
@KING Lvl999 夢 в том
@Stus777
@Stus777 3 жыл бұрын
9
@Stus777
@Stus777 3 жыл бұрын
@KING Lvl999 夢 Про
@panizfarahi9023
@panizfarahi9023 11 ай бұрын
LOL
@MaCCabOOi92
@MaCCabOOi92 2 жыл бұрын
Äpple sallad ppp9pppppp
@gyawimovement9164
@gyawimovement9164 3 жыл бұрын
The harsh taxi pragmatically bake because transmission sporadically battle beneath a tall swordfish. tricky, dirty impulse
My Initial Impresson Of Go
12:39
TheVimeagen
Рет қаралды 26 М.
Chips evolution !! 😔😔
00:23
Tibo InShape
Рет қаралды 18 МЛН
маленький брат прыгает в бассейн
00:15
GL Show Russian
Рет қаралды 4,3 МЛН
Buy Feastables, Win Unlimited Money
00:51
MrBeast 2
Рет қаралды 97 МЛН
React Native vs Flutter in 2024 - Make the RIGHT Choice (Difference Explained)
10:31
Daniel Dan | Tech & Data
Рет қаралды 122 М.
ChatGPT Can Now Talk Like a Human [Latest Updates]
22:21
ColdFusion
Рет қаралды 284 М.
Sodium-ion batteries in the USA. Beating China at their own game!
12:52
Just Have a Think
Рет қаралды 132 М.
How to build a chat using Lambda + WebSocket + API Gateway? (nodejs)
25:29
FULL FLIGHT! Blue Origin NS-25 Crew Launch
10:40
The Launch Pad
Рет қаралды 20 М.
React.js just got a major upgrade
14:38
Mehul - Codedamn
Рет қаралды 88 М.
What’s the Best React Native Storage Option? 🧐
12:53
Simon Grimm
Рет қаралды 28 М.
Girl camera photo Editing 3d with adobe Photoshop /9/33/Am
0:43
Amir TECh
Рет қаралды 252 М.
Готовый миниПК от Intel (но от китайцев)
36:25
Ремонтяш
Рет қаралды 423 М.
Apple watch hidden camera
0:34
_vector_
Рет қаралды 17 МЛН
Introducing the all-new iPad Pro | Apple
1:29
Apple
Рет қаралды 37 МЛН
Я Создал Новый Айфон!
0:59
FLV
Рет қаралды 3,5 МЛН
Что еще за обходная зарядка?
0:30
Не шарю!
Рет қаралды 2,2 МЛН